Raymond Kocher Obituary

Raymond E. Kocher, 80, of Kunkletown, formerly of Palmerton, passed away on Saturday, January 16, 2016, at his residence. He was the husband of Shirley A. (Newman) Kocher. They celebrated their 61st wedding anniversary last April 24th. Born in Nazareth on February 07, 1935, he was a son of the late Lewis Sr. and Mary (Rodger) Kocher. Together with his wife, Shirley, Raymond owned and operated the Shir-Ray Inn in Palmerton for 28 years before retiring. Previously, he was a truck driver for several years and a member of the International Brotherhood of Teamsters Local 773, Allentown. Raymond was also a member of the Nazareth American Legion, and he enjoyed NASCAR and was an ardent Jeff Gordon fan. Survivors: In addition to his loving wife, Shirley, he is survived by a brother, Sherwood Kocher of Bath; two sisters, Dorothy Hess of Lower Nazareth Township and Emily Baggest and her husband, August of Northampton; a sister-in-law, Mildred Kolb of Whitehall; many nieces and nephews. He was predeceased by his son, Keith E. Kocher in 2009, as well as four brothers, Elwood Sr., John Sr., William Sr. and Lewis Jr., and four sisters, Alice Barrall, Beatrice Houser, Bessie Fogel and Mildred Frey.
